Start Including Area Codes

John AndersonOctober 20, 2021

You’ll need to include the area code when making most phone calls in Kansas or, starting Sunday, the call won’t go through. Ten-digit dialing will be required for people living in the 785 and 620 area codes when they make local calls starting Oct. 24. In Honor of General Colin Powell

John AndersonOctober 19, 2021

American flags have been ordered to be flown at half-staff in honor of General Colin Powell after he died on Monday due to complications of COVID-19. STREET PAVING WORK

John AndersonOctober 13, 2021

APAC Shears, Inc. along with Bar S Construction, both of Salina, will be performing street construction and paving work for the City of Abilene starting this Friday, October 15. Early stages of this work, over the next 2 weeks, will be primarily at intersections and alley entrances. Hit and Run

John AndersonOctober 11, 2021

A 66-year-old Wichita man was killed in a two-vehicle hit and run near Arrowhead Stadium following the Chiefs game against Buffalo Sunday night. The man was attempting to cross Blue Ridge Cutoff on foot from west to east when he was struck by a southbound vehicle, which left the scene without stopping. FATAILITY SOUTH OF HERINGTON

John AndersonOctober 1, 2021

Kansas Highway Patrol Trooper Ben Gardner said the accident happened on US-77/US-56 about two miles south of Herington shortly before 12:30 p.m. Friday. Gardner said the crash involved two vehicles, a semi-tractor trailer and passenger car. The driver of the car was pronounced dead at the scene.
